outcomes Case Study 1 Unraveling the Mystery of the Unexplained Fatigue A 35yearold woman presents with persistent fatigue despite adequate sleep and a healthy 2 lifestyle Her primary care physician orders a comprehensive blood panel which reveals elevated levels of thyroidstimulating hormone TSH and low levels of free thyroxine T4 Analysis These findings suggest hypothyroidism a condition where the thyroid gland doesnt produce enough hormones Ethical Considerations This case highlights the importance of respecting patient confidentiality The doctor must discuss the test results and treatment options with the patient in a sensitive and confidential manner ensuring the patients autonomy and right to make informed decisions about their health Case Study 2 The Athlete with Unusually High Creatinine Levels A 20yearold competitive athlete undergoes routine blood work before a major competition His results show significantly elevated creatinine levels Analysis Elevated creatinine levels can indicate kidney dysfunction However in this case the athlete is known to consume high protein diets and engage in intense physical activity both of which can influence creatinine levels Further investigation is needed to determine if the elevated creatinine is indicative of a real concern or simply a result of lifestyle factors Ethical Considerations This case emphasizes the importance of considering individual patient factors and lifestyle choices when interpreting laboratory results It also highlights the ethical obligation to provide clear and accurate information to patients allowing them to understand the significance of their test results and make informed decisions about their care Case Study 3 The Diabetic Patient with Unexpectedly High Blood Sugar Levels A 55yearold diabetic patient presents for a routine checkup Despite being on a strict medication regimen his blood sugar levels are consistently elevated Analysis High blood sugar levels in a diabetic patient could be due to several factors including inadequate medication dosage poor adherence to diet and exercise guidelines or underlying health issues like a secondary infection Ethical Considerations This case demonstrates the importance of maintaining open and honest communication with patients addressing their concerns and actively involving them in managing their condition It also highlights the ethical responsibility to ensure patients have access to accurate information and resources to help them manage their diabetes effectively Discussion of Ethical Considerations 3 Clinical chemistry
